> I'm trying to update Bison on Solaris 11.3. Configure is failing with:
>
> checking for GNU M4 that supports accurate traces... configure: error:
> no acceptable m4 could be found in $PATH.
> GNU M4 1.4.6 or later is required; 1.4.16 or newer is recommended.
> GNU M4 1.4.15 uses a buggy replacement strstr on some systems.
> Glibc 2.9 - 2.12 and GNU M4 1.4.11 - 1.4.15 have another strstr bug.
>
> Gnulib has strstr. Perhaps you can use it instead of spending time
> with the old or buggy versions. Also see
> https://www.gnu.org/software/gnulib/manual/gnulib.html#c_002dstrstr.
Exactly. So please, install a version of m4 that uses a version
of gnulib recent enough. Follow the advice and install the latest
version of M4.
